Our Wilsonville plumber assesses your current plumbing system thoroughly before recommending repiping. We check pipe material and condition, test water pressure, map the existing layout, and identify the most efficient approach for your specific home.
Our crew runs new supply pipes through walls, floors, and ceilings — making small, strategic access openings to minimize drywall damage. All pipe connections are made with quality fittings and supported correctly throughout the run.
Magnet Plumbing pressure tests the completed repipe in your Wilsonville, CT home before any drywall patches are made. We confirm every joint, connection, and fixture stub-out is leak-free under full operating pressure before closing up walls.
After passing pressure tests, our Wilsonville crew patches all drywall access points, restores water service, and runs every fixture in your home to demonstrate full water pressure and flow throughout the new plumbing system.
